Description
Saint Macuil, known as the Wind Caller, is a legendary dragon-like entity and a former tactician of Seiros during the War of Heroes. He embodies the mastery of wind magic and serves as a guardian and arbiter of power, testing those who seek to prove their strength.

Crest of Macuil
Macuil can channel the power of his crest to enhance his spells. Once per turn, when he casts a spell, he can add an additional 1d10 damage of a type of his choice.
Desert Mirage
Macuil creates illusory duplicates of himself, confusing his enemies. Until the end of his next turn, he can make a DC 20 Intelligence saving throw to create 1d4 illusory duplicates that last for 1 minute.
Tactical Retreat
As a bonus action, Macuil can teleport up to 120 feet to an unoccupied space he can see, leaving behind a gust of wind that knocks creatures within 10 feet of his departure point prone.
Wind Slash
Saint Macuil unleashes a powerful gust of wind in a 60-foot line that is 10 feet wide. Each creature in that line must make a DC 20 Dexterity saving throw, taking 45 (10d8) slashing damage on a failed save, or half as much damage on a successful one.
